Responsibilities

  • Create and edit HD maps (lanes, intersections, routes, regulatory elements, goal poses) using JOSM and our in-house lanelet tooling on the Lanelet2 / OpenStreetMap data model.
  • Validate every change in simulation first, then test on the tractor in Atlanta as needed.
  • Capture evidence (sim videos, test results, before/after diffs) and document testing results
  • Maintain map hygiene - pruning duplicates, keeping naming and versioning consistent, and documenting the process so it scales beyond one person.
  • Coordinate with external mapping vendors to validate and integrate large-scale map deliveries.

  • We are looking for a Mapping Engineer to own the creation and validation of the high-definition maps that our autonomous tractors drive on. AeroVect builds category-defining autonomy for airport airside operations, and every deployment depends on accurate, safe, production-grade maps of structured, low-speed environments - taxiways, aircraft stands, and indoor baggage halls.
  • This is a hands-on, end-to-end ownership role based on-site in Atlanta. You'll be the single point of contact for incoming mapping requests, build and update maps through our map repository and Map CI pipeline, and validate map changes in simulation and on the tractor here in Atlanta before it ships. You'll work closely with autonomy, operations, and test engineers, and report into the mapping/autonomy team.
